What You’re Actually Paying For When You Hire A Real Estate Agent

</p><br><p>When you hire a real estate agent to help you sell your property, the commission you pay is often seen as a fixed slice of the sale price. However, what that commission actually covers goes transcends just arranging walkthroughs or signing paperwork. A real estate agent&#8217;s commission is compensation for a diverse array of professional services, time, market insight, and personal financial burden that go into ensuring a seamless closing.<br></p><img src="https://p0.pikist.com/photos/336/672/fruit-strawberries-red-sweet-food-basket-thumbnail.jpg" style="max-width:400px;float:left;padding:10px 10px 10px 0px;border:0px;"><br><p>First and foremost, the commission pays for the agent&#8217;s deep expertise of the area property trends. Real estate values fluctuate based on neighborhood trends, educational zones, municipal codes, upcoming developments, and even seasonal demand. An seasoned professional uses this insight to set an optimal listing price or help a buyer make a competitive offer that captures intrinsic worth. Too high a price results in a property sitting on the market for months. Undervaluing leads to sacrificing maximum return. The agent&#8217;s ability to navigate pricing nuances is priceless and comes from continuous market analysis.<br></p><br><p>The commission also covers the expense of exposing the home to buyers. This includes high-end real estate imagery, 3D walkthroughs, aerial videography, staging consultations, and engaging marketing copy. Agents often allocate budget to targeted digital ads on platforms like Realtor.com, LinkedIn, and MLS networks to attract qualified buyers. For sellers, this marketing effort is critical to creating urgency. For buyers, it means having access to the most current listings, including those shared only with agents.<br></p><br><p>Another major component is the dedicated hours involved in managing the entire process of the transaction. Agents coordinate showings, community walkthroughs, property evaluations, appraisals, and negotiated fixes. They liaise with several professionals including lenders, title companies, <a href="https://blogfreely.net/ptrealestateguide/common-mistakes-first-time-sellers-make-and-how-to-avoid-them">First-time home seller Peterborough</a> inspectors, real estate lawyers, and handymen. This requires uninterrupted accessibility, exceptional planning ability, and attention to detail, often going past 9-to-5. Many agents sacrifice personal time to respect client availability.<br></p><br><p>Legal and administrative responsibilities are also part of the package. Real estate contracts are complex documents filled with contingencies, transparency obligations, and closings windows. An agent ensures all forms are filled out correctly and on time to prevent financial penalties. They assist clients in negotiations, clarify counteroffers, and champion their client&#8217;s goals during the entire closing journey.<br></p><br><p>There is also an component of personal investment. Agents typically cover upfront expenses for promotional materials, field work, CRM tools, and administrative overhead. They are receiving income after a deal closes, meaning weeks of effort may produce zero revenue if a transaction falls through. This invisible workload is a significant part of the business model and is built into the commission structure.<br></p><br><p>Additionally, agents allocate resources to professional development, state dues, brokerage affiliations, and technology tools to keep pace in an dynamic real estate environment. They must comprehend capital gains laws, financing options, and local regulations that can influence outcomes. Many also offer reassurance to clients during what can be a mentally draining ordeal.<br></p><br><p>In essence, the commission is not just a fee for a task completed on closing day&#8212;it is payment for a comprehensive range of expertise, work, investment, and tools that ensure the transaction is executed skillfully, ethically, and seamlessly. Understanding this helps clients appreciate why working with a experienced advisor often leads to better outcomes than trying to manage the real estate market.<br></p>
